The phrase "a greater decrease of the"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when discussing a comparative reduction in quantity, size, or intensity in a specific context.
Example: "The study revealed a greater decrease of the population in urban areas compared to rural regions."
Alternatives: "a larger reduction in" or "a more significant decline in".
